How to Get There

  • The Winter Gardens is conveniently located in the heart of Harrogate, just a short walk from many popular attractions such as the Royal Pump Room Museum and Harrogate Theatre.
  • For those arriving by car, there are several nearby car parks such as the Jubilee and Victoria multi-storey car parks.
  • If you prefer public transportation, the venue is just a short walk from the Harrogate bus and train stations.
